FC Bayern Fansparen at a Glance

FC Bayern Fansparen is an instant-access savings account from "meine Volksbank Raiffeisenbank", themed around supporters of FC Bayern Munich. It combines a variable savings rate with an additional bonus payment tied to the club's sporting success — an unusual combination in the German savings market.

Interest Rate

The stored product data lists the rate as 0.68% p.a., valid for balances between €500 and €100,000. Important context: according to the provider's offer page, this is not a fixed, guaranteed rate but a variable one, transparently linked to the monthly EURIBOR average — specifically, the provider pays "30% of it". The stated 0.68% p.a. is therefore the currently applicable rate, which can move up or down with the monthly EURIBOR adjustment. No tiered structure with different rates for different balance levels is visible on the offer page.

Terms and Fees

Opening the account requires a minimum deposit of €500, which matches the lower balance threshold in the product data. The balance is available daily according to the provider. Withdrawals require a personal reference account to be registered, through which deposits and withdrawals are processed — so the Fansparen account does not function as a fully standalone account but requires an existing checking account (at any bank) as a reference. The account can be opened online, and according to the provider is now also available to minors.

Beyond the regular interest, the bank advertises a seasonal bonus promotion: anyone holding a balance of at least €5,000 by March 31 receives a €50 bonus; from €15,000 it is €100 — but only if FC Bayern Munich is Bundesliga table leader on that date. This bonus is therefore neither guaranteed nor part of the regular interest payment, but an extra chance tied to a sporting outcome that savers cannot rely on.

Verdict

FC Bayern Fansparen is primarily a niche, brand-driven product for fans of the club rather than a savings account optimized for maximum returns. At 0.68% p.a. — variable and linked to EURIBOR — the running rate is noticeably below what current top savings offers pay, and the additional fan bonus depends on a sporting condition outside the saver's control. For genuine FC Bayern supporters who value the emotional appeal, the account can still be interesting; anyone looking purely at the interest rate will find better alternatives on the market.
